Transaction ce2697f76dbb35e160577dcf3e573f1195781ac3e9b9cddecfbde77deaad3d51
3 Input
2 Outputs
- ce2697f76dbb35e160577dcf3e573f1195781ac3e9b9cddecfbde77deaad3d51:0
- ce2697f76dbb35e160577dcf3e573f1195781ac3e9b9cddecfbde77deaad3d51:1
value 2000000
address 3C3QVniJcQcmZhR3Lj8qU1fnK4dFh6Mohm
value 517814
address 15gfYshv8w8GSq9m1M9RmbPQPnLSuDHhZa